How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fishers?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Fishers Studio Apartments | $1,526 | $963 | $7,056 |
Fishers 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,495 | $850 | $4,426 |
Fishers 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,792 | $1,100 | $4,858 |
Fishers 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,446 | $1,504 | $10,000+ |
Fishers 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,272 | $2,650 | $5,214 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Fishers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Fishers with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Fishers is at Scandia Apartments listed at $1,504.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Fishers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Fishers is $2,446.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Fishers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Fishers is a 1,759 square feet unit starting from $1,504 at Scandia Apartments.
What is the average size for Fishers 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Fishers is currently 2,081 sq ft.
